Abstract
Brown and Bimrose map changing ideas about the development of identities at work and then outline two models of learning for supporting identity development at work. The most recent model by Brown and Bimrose draws attention to three representations of key factors influencing learning and identity development at work. The first representation views learning as a process of identity development: ‘learning as becoming’. The second way learning and identity development can be represented is as occurring across four domains: relational development; cognitive development; practical development and emotional development. Learning may involve development in one or more domains. The third way that learning and identity development at work can be represented acknowledges that learning takes place in the context of opportunity structures within which individuals operate.
